Health and disease have long inspired both scientific investigation and philosophical inquiry. While modern medicine explains illness through genetics, physiology, infectious agents, environmental exposures, immune function, and other biological mechanisms, a variety of alternative health theories seek to understand disease from different perspectives. Among the most widely discussed—and most controversial—is German New Medicine (GNM), a theory developed by the late Dr. Ryke Geerd Hamer.German New Medicine proposes that many diseases originate from unexpected emotional conflicts that trigger meaningful biological responses involving the mind, the brain, and the body's organs. According to GNM, these responses follow what Dr. Hamer described as the Five Biological Laws, which he believed could explain the development and resolution of illness. Supporters view GNM as a holistic framework that emphasizes emotional awareness, self-reflection, and the interconnectedness of psychological and physical health.Despite its popularity in some alternative health communities, German New Medicine has not been validated through rigorous scientific research. Its central claims—including its explanations for cancer, diabetes, arthritis, autoimmune diseases, allergies, heart disease, and other conditions—are not accepted by mainstream medicine. Modern medical research has established that these illnesses arise through complex biological processes involving genetics, immune responses, metabolism, environmental influences, aging, infections, and numerous other factors.
